Field Visit (5 January 2016)

This sheepfold is situated on gently sloping ground in semi-improved pasture on a terrace above the Limiecleuch Burn about 70m NE of a sheep shelter. It measures about 4m in diameter within a bracken- and grass-grown turf bank 2m thick and 0.2m high, which is encircled by a turf-stripping hollow 2m broad and 0.2m deep. It overlies traces of rig and furrow.

Visited by RCAHMS (ATW, HGW), 5 January 2016.
